Each summer I spend time reviewing the tools that I use in my classroom and that I recommend to teachers like you.

Today I'd like to share my favorite apps, add-ons, and extensions for the ELA classroom. 

This collection of tools will help your students become better readers and writers and will also help you provide better support and feedback on their written work.
